当前位置: 技术问答>linux和unix
telnet命令
来源: 互联网 发布时间:2016-06-13
本文导语: 使用telnet远程连接unix 怎样操作可以快速显示之前有过的操作指令?我不是指简单的向上,下翻,类似于打一个提示符,然后搜索,命令就 出现了。 还有就是,能快速显示之前有使用过的文件名,类似于以上所说。 我...
使用telnet远程连接unix
怎样操作可以快速显示之前有过的操作指令?我不是指简单的向上,下翻,类似于打一个提示符,然后搜索,命令就
出现了。
还有就是,能快速显示之前有使用过的文件名,类似于以上所说。
我问了很多人,不知道是我表达的有问题,还是。。
我见过有人用,能节省很多时间,请高手回答,谢谢!!!!!!!!
怎样操作可以快速显示之前有过的操作指令?我不是指简单的向上,下翻,类似于打一个提示符,然后搜索,命令就
出现了。
还有就是,能快速显示之前有使用过的文件名,类似于以上所说。
我问了很多人,不知道是我表达的有问题,还是。。
我见过有人用,能节省很多时间,请高手回答,谢谢!!!!!!!!
|
我想你是说tab键吧?
|
按tab键
|
先打一个字母,tab
|
我知道楼主的意思了,楼主说的是命令行编辑。
可以这样,如果你熟悉vi的话,在命令行里面输入
set -o vi
然后就可以向使用vi一样来编辑命令行了。
比如你要查找一个命令,先按esc然后/your-command
就可以开始查找了,n是下一个,这些命令跟vi是一样的。
如果你喜欢emacs
可以 set -o emacs
可以这样,如果你熟悉vi的话,在命令行里面输入
set -o vi
然后就可以向使用vi一样来编辑命令行了。
比如你要查找一个命令,先按esc然后/your-command
就可以开始查找了,n是下一个,这些命令跟vi是一样的。
如果你喜欢emacs
可以 set -o emacs
|
lz说的是这个吧
[root@RHEL4_U5 ~]# history | head
19 cd eaccelerator-0.9.5.3
20 /usr/local/webserver/php/bin/phpize
21 ./configure --enable-eaccelerator=shared --with-php-config=/usr/local/webserver/php/bin/php-config
22 make ; make install ; cd ..
23 rm -fr /software/root.cpio
24 pwd
25 ll
26 tar zxvf PDO_MYSQL-1.0.2.tgz
27 cd PDO_MYSQL-1.0.2/
28 /usr/local/webserver/php/bin/phpize
然后再加一个grep就可以过滤出你想要的命令了,都是你之前敲过的命令
还有一个就是当前打开的所有文件
[root@RHEL4_U5 ~]# lsof | head
COMMAND PID USER FD TYPE DEVICE SIZE NODE NAME
init 1 root cwd DIR 8,3 4096 2 /
init 1 root rtd DIR 8,3 4096 2 /
init 1 root txt REG 8,3 32716 1370941 /sbin/init
init 1 root mem REG 8,3 56336 1422777 /lib/libselinux.so.1
init 1 root mem REG 8,3 112168 1422757 /lib/ld-2.3.4.so
init 1 root mem REG 8,3 1529008 1422759 /lib/tls/libc-2.3.4.so
init 1 root mem REG 8,3 53736 1419949 /lib/libsepol.so.1
init 1 root 10u FIFO 0,13 1472 /dev/initctl
migration 2 root cwd DIR 8,3 4096 2 /
[root@RHEL4_U5 ~]# history | head
19 cd eaccelerator-0.9.5.3
20 /usr/local/webserver/php/bin/phpize
21 ./configure --enable-eaccelerator=shared --with-php-config=/usr/local/webserver/php/bin/php-config
22 make ; make install ; cd ..
23 rm -fr /software/root.cpio
24 pwd
25 ll
26 tar zxvf PDO_MYSQL-1.0.2.tgz
27 cd PDO_MYSQL-1.0.2/
28 /usr/local/webserver/php/bin/phpize
然后再加一个grep就可以过滤出你想要的命令了,都是你之前敲过的命令
还有一个就是当前打开的所有文件
[root@RHEL4_U5 ~]# lsof | head
COMMAND PID USER FD TYPE DEVICE SIZE NODE NAME
init 1 root cwd DIR 8,3 4096 2 /
init 1 root rtd DIR 8,3 4096 2 /
init 1 root txt REG 8,3 32716 1370941 /sbin/init
init 1 root mem REG 8,3 56336 1422777 /lib/libselinux.so.1
init 1 root mem REG 8,3 112168 1422757 /lib/ld-2.3.4.so
init 1 root mem REG 8,3 1529008 1422759 /lib/tls/libc-2.3.4.so
init 1 root mem REG 8,3 53736 1419949 /lib/libsepol.so.1
init 1 root 10u FIFO 0,13 1472 /dev/initctl
migration 2 root cwd DIR 8,3 4096 2 /
|
history --help 有具体参数
|
tab
|
按tab键